Hi again, see if you can find VHT brand over there, they make a glossy HT as well as the brake and caliper paint. However, the gloss black HT paint will not stand up to as high a temperature as the Brake and caliper paint.

Hi and welcome to the forum. VHT brand of brake and caliper paint seems to be a forum favorite for fireboxes. It does come in semi gloss and a tougher to find glossy version which I know other members have found in the UK.
I live in the US and had trouble finding glossy, but finally did...can in my hand is labeled:
VHT engine enamel
up to 550 deg. F (288 deg C) Drive Train Paint
Chemical Resistant
Gloss Black
Product Number SP-124
Maybe a check of their website would give you local dealers...I buy mine from an auto parts store.

I have spent 4 months researching a good Black Gloss VHT paint to use in my Bowman E101 firebox housing.
Finally at lunch time today I ordered a can of VHT Black Gloss Calliper paint that goes to 900°F and is easy to cure even on a BBQ it seems.
I ordered from Rally design and now I see its also been recommended to you earlier in this string by Atticman. He is spot on I recon it’s the best you are going to get in the UK anyway.
